On the hardware, different transmitter/receiver algorithms, whichdescribe transmission st<strong>and</strong>ards, could be executed for corresponding application software.For instance, the software can be specified in such a manner that several st<strong>and</strong>ards can beloaded via parameter configurations. This strategy can offer a seamless change/adaptationof st<strong>and</strong>ards, if necessary.The software-defined radio can be characterized by the following features:– The radio functionality is configured per software.– Different st<strong>and</strong>ards can be executed on the hardware according to the parameter lists.
